    Many people are having this issue with web connect. I can access the RDP
    Web Connect Page on my LAN from another computer on the LAN. I can
    access my computer using remote desktop client from another location
    (work) as well as my LAN, I just can't remote desktop webconnect from
    the internet. People get confused with remote desktop and remote desktop
    web connect. Remote desktop is easy, it's web connect that is a pain in
    the butt (only on vista).

    Remote desktop webconnect comes in handy when you are on a computer
    that does not have the client remote desktop software (ie stipped down
    client computers on a corporate LAN). With webconnect, there is no limit
    to RDP connection to your box so long as you have internet access.

    I have all the necessary ports open on my router and firewall,
    including port forwarding etc. Vista sucks with web connect. Finnicky.
    XP was a sinch.

    Again, I can access my box using web connect on my lan so the issue
    must be a vista firewall. Can-u-see-me sees my machine and open
    port...just not web connect. What is up????
